Alan Briscoe was graduated from Oakland University in June,
1991 with a Master’s Degree in Counseling.He is a Licensed Professional Counselor.
Alan, formerly a General Motors engineer, is especially
sensitive to what many automotive employees are presently experiencing through
anxiety and fear of separation from their chosen careers and retirement issues.
Alan works with men’s issues, specifically, men going
through crisis – either in their personal life or their business life.He has worked with both men and women in the areas of
depression and anxiety.Alan also is
privileged to work with older male adolescents, marital counseling and
substance abuse. Alan also specializes in working with Military, Police, and Fire Fighters.
He has done work over the years as a volunteer
counselor at Common Ground. He has facilitated working with children involved
with divorce recovery, co-facilitated an on-going Grief Share program at his
home church, Faith Lutheran in Troy, Michigan and has been an Event Director
for Special Olympics for the past 21 years.
